The traditional Ijaw marriage process begins with the introduction called ware ogiga gbolo which loosely translates to knocking. On a previous visit, the suitor would have let the bride’s parents know of his intention to marry their daughter. He would be presented with a list on this first visit. The list will contain the things he and his kin will come with on the day of the introduction.
